>> On another note, a warning about Mexican Pings. They *do not* like
>> standing in water. I filled the tray they are in with a few cm of
>> water. They are potted in 8cm pots. They sat in this water for
>> about two weeks. It is a good thing I had recently taken leaf
>> cuttings, since this experiment with laziness has cost me several
>> plants from rotting.

>Barry, my _P.zecheri_ always sits in water and seem to do O.K.

A lot of my plants are in standing water; an advantage for me is the
ability to control water availability when I go out of town. It sounds
like the distance from the water to the root zone is important for pings
(and other CP?). Anyone care to comment about the depth of their
typical pots for different species? Tom
